Offer Description
This project aims to create high resolution 3D images of optically cleared clinical tissue samples (e.g. biopsies) with optical diffraction tomography (ODT) for clinical diagnosis. The research will involve work on the biochemistry of optical tissue clearing and imaging of (clinically relevant) tissues using an existing set-up. The post-doc will perform proof of principle experiments that show the potential of ODT for 3D digital imaging of large volume tissue resections, compare the results to conventional histology, and translate the results to a clinical environment.
The research will partly be performed at the Department of Imaging Physics at the faculty of Applied Sciences of the DelftUniversity of Technology where the focus will be on the tomographic and microscopic imaging, under the supervision of dr. Jeroen Kalkman.
The clinical oriented research part focusing on tissue processing will be carried out in the Pathology department of the Erasmus Medical Center under the supervision of dr. Martin van Royen. The post-doc will be located at both institutions. This project is part of an Erasmus-TU Delft convergence program that aims to stimulate medical technology innovation and foster clinical-technological collaboration. It is also part of a larger effort in the Cancer Diagnostics 3.0 program.
